    Stockghyll cottage is an excellent place to stay to explore the beautiful lake district. Within 10 minutes walk to the centre of bowness on windermere Stockghyll cottage has 3 rooms. we stayed in room 2, the larger double room, although not exactly large it was well equipped with a double bed shower, a small t.v wardrobe, and bedside draws kettle with coffee and tea . Heather and Adrian, the hosts are very welcoming and always happy to help The breakfast is excellent offering cerals fruit, fresh juice, and full English breakfast and lighter options like scrambled or poached eggs on toast tea coffee home made preserves jams marmalaid honey . Ample on-site car parking And just across the road from the windermere Museum and access to Lake windermere We also want to share a secret with you, but don't tell everyone At the rear of the property, there's a bench overlooking a beautiful waterfall ,we would return after our day's adventure and sit out on the bench with a nice bottle of wine perfect way to end the day. We highly recommend Stockghyll cottage Stayed 16/6/25 -19/6/25 Terry n Carole
